Plot Summary
Makoto, a high school student, discovers she has the ability to time travel. Initially, she uses this power for trivial matters like avoiding tests and reliving fun moments. However, as she learns more about the consequences of altering the past, Makoto faces increasingly complex dilemmas, ultimately having to make a difficult choice about her future and the future of those she cares about.
